Recently I upgraded both my desktop computer and my laptop to MX 19. All
went very well. I used the same USB stick for both, so all profiles were
identical. Why am I saying this?
I have several email accounts in use on TBird. Today one of them, also
named accounts, was not receiving mail on the desk top computer. The
others accounts were fine. When I checked I found that, just on that one
account, the subscribe list was empty. I tried refresh and a few other
ideas, but it remained empty. This was obviously the reason for no new
emails appearing.
Just as a check I logged on to the laptop and ran TBird. Perfect,
everything working as expected. The subscribe list on accounts was fine,
and all the other were fine too. Some new emails appeared on accounts,
which had not turned up on the desktop.
What baffles me is that the two machines should have the same set up for
TBird. Yet one is working properly, and the other one has a problem.
